I've been trying to battle Lighting, Snow and Ice on Skyrim for weeks! The Performance Benchmarking steps are to select "Breezehome" so that's become the standard I've used, then I would catch the wagon to Winterhold to see snow and ice and go into the Frozen Hearth. Ice worked well with RIM - Real Ice reMastered and though it took some time for me to remember what I read in the Majestic Mountains Readme the snow from RIS - Real Ice and Snow has been great once I replaced it's projecteddiffuse.dds with a copy of it's renamed snow01.dds. Lighting on the other hand has been confusing for me, no matter how I edited things or if I disabled lighting altogether it always looked like things were darker than it should be. It got me so confused I disabled everything except the 02 - Extenders and Alternate Start to follow the Performance Benchmarking steps and there were no longer dark shadows over the swords and shield on the wall...

I tried again to work out what was causing that outside of the 18 - Lighting. Was it Soft Shadows that I'd installed in preparation for 2.4? No it wasn't that, I also removed RIS - Real Ice and Snow and reinstalled Fixed Mesh Lighting without selecting the patch for RIS just on the off chance since I was so confused... I'm posting it all here because it's not Lighting at all but the Sword and Shield textures themselves that make them look like they are in shadow and I found a post in aMidianBorn Book of Silence SE's page talking about it.

 

 aMidianBorn Book of Silence SE iron textures are extremely dark for me so I've a screenshot of it disabled and enabled with 18 - Lighting but without 21 - Post Processing:

d3ZSuGX.jpg

Are the Iron Weapons that dark usually for aMidianBorn Book of Silence SE or is it because I've installed the Weapons pack modular?  As I'm using Ancient Amidianborn Dwarven Armory I've not included Dwemer in the Armors or Weapons pack and I'm now thinking of not including Iron in the weapons pack as well because how dark they are make it hard for me to see any details on them.
